I went there last night. The food was great and the service rather prompt. Luckily, it wasn't busy. I am giving it a 3-star rating because when paying by card, I noticed that the tip calculation is off. For a $34 meal and a 15% tip, the amount shown was $44 dollars, which is clearly not 15%. I tried customizing the amount and the tip ended up being double than what I wanted to leave. My recommendation is: pay only the amount on your bill by card and the tip in cash.

Restaurant response
Response added on 10 Feb 2026
Hi TJ, The tipping is confusing because of how the payment systems work. This is a UI issue for ALL restaurants and ALL payment systems in Québec. So the first amount shown, the $34, is the SUBTOTAL. You tip on the subtotal, which at 15% is about $5. Then the final amount you see is the total WITH TAX AND TIP. The tax is around 15%, which is about $5; so that combined with your $5 tip makes the final $44. I hope that helps clarify.
